> The current setting of surefire trims stack traces if it reaches JUnit. This makes debugging harder, because it's not obvious what code path is affected:
> {noformat}
> java.io.EOFException: End of File Exception between local host is: "asf918.gq1.ygridcore.net/67.195.81.138"; destination host is: "localhost":35969; : java.io.EOFException; For more details see:  http://wiki.apache.org/hadoop/EOFException
> 	at org.apache.oozie.util.TestZKUtilsWithSecurity.setUp(TestZKUtilsWithSecurity.java:36)
> Caused by: java.io.EOFException
> {noformat}
> We have to see the full trace in order to address problems efficiently.
